History

Building Research Systems, Inc (BRS)  is a product development company with extensive knowledge of the metal building industry, specializing in development of standing seam roofing systems and innovational products for the advancement of metal roofs. BRS was started in 1994 by Leo Neyer who previously worked for several metal building manufacturers including Butler Manufacturing Co, Stran Buildings, Star Manufacturing and Encon Consultants in their business group developing standing seam roofing systems and refining metal building products. He utilized his extensive 30 years of Metal Building industry experience of developing and selling building systems to create a unique business model to allow companies to sell and market their own fully tested standing seam roofing systems without the research or development costs normally associated with this endeavor.

The first industry leading product BRS developed was the 2” vertical standing seam pan panel PanelCraft 216/218 roof system, incorporating the BRS patented proprietary TripleLok® and QuadLok® side lap joinery seams.
